Why a woman hates the other woman more than her ᴄʜᴇᴀᴛɪɴɢ husband

It has been known that men are unfaithful to their wives from times as ancient as the mythologies. Obviously, we do not mean all men are like this, but history is proof that many of them are.

There could be a lot of reasons behind this action of theirs, but whatever the reason might be, it is something that is totally unethical and unacceptable.

However, often the wives do a very strange thing when they find out that their husband is having an 𝖆𝖋𝖋𝖆𝖎𝖗.

They blame only the other woman, curse her and call her all sorts of bad names, and not their own spouse who too broke the barriers of trust and commitment.
